Abstract:Enhancing the participation of PPP social capital is of great significance to stimulate effective investment. Select 61 characteristic variables in four dimensions of the project itself, local government, market environment, and macroeconomics, build a prediction model of social capital PPP participation based on an ensemble learning algorithm, and explore the influence mechanism of different feature combinations on social capital participation in PPP. The research results show that: 1) Dragonfly algorithm effectively improving the accuracy of the prediction models with feature dimensionality reduction. 2)The prediction model based on ADASYN+XGBoost achieves the best performance under the combination of the characteristics of the project itself, local government and macroeconomics. 3)Among them, the project itself has the most significant impact on social capital participation in PPP, followed by local government; the addition of market environment will reduce the accuracy of the model under other characteristic combinations except the project itself; local governments should focus on attracting active investment from social capital by improving fiscal transparency, improving integrity, and optimizing public-private cooperation mechanisms.
